In order to realize the real-time measurement and control of geosynchronous orbit satellite during the process of global deployment,a TT&C scheme with comprehensive utilization of satellite-ground link and inter-sat-ellite link is proposed in this paper.Based on the two stages divided by the scheme,wherein one is in the view stage and the other one is out of sight stage,a time-sharing heterogeneous architecture is constructed.In this archi-tecture,satellite-ground link is mainly used in stage one when ground station can control satellite directly,and in-ter-satellite link is the only way to measurement the object when it is out of the ground station visual range.A varie-ty of different inter-satellite links,such as inter-satellite link with observation-data-relay satellite and TDRS/BD in-ter-satellite link,are utilized.Furthermore,the communication link budget is calculated and the mission reliability is analyzed.The result shows that the scheme is feasible and reliable.
